import streamlit as st
from fhir.resources.observation import Observation
from datetime import datetime
import requests
import json
# FHIR server endpoint
base_url = "https://<fhir_server_endpoint>/fhir/"
# Function to create an Observation resource
def create_observation_resource(activity, category, calories, duration, distance, heart_rate):
observation = Observation()
observation.status = "final"
observation.category = [{"coding": [{"system": "http://terminology.hl7.org/CodeSystem/observation-category",
"code": "activity"}]}]
observation.code = {"coding": [{"system": "http://loinc.org", "code": "55409-7", "display": "Exercise tracking panel"}]}
observation.effectiveDateTime = datetime.now().isoformat()
observation.component = []
if activity:
observation.component.append({"code": {"coding": [{"system": "http://loinc.org", "code": "73985-4", "display": "Exercise activity"}]}, "valueString": activity})
if category:
observation.component.append({"code": {"coding": [{"system": "http://loinc.org", "code": "73986-2", "display": "Exercise aerobic category"}]}, "valueString": category})
if calories:
observation.component.append({"code": {"coding": [{"system": "http://loinc.org", "code": "55421-2", "display": "Calories burned Machine estimate"}]}, "valueQuantity": {"value": calories, "unit": "kcal"}})
if duration:
observation.component.append({"code": {"coding": [{"system": "http://loinc.org", "code": "55411-3", "display": "Exercise duration"}]}, "valueQuantity": {"value": duration, "unit": "min"}})
if distance:
observation.component.append({"code": {"coding": [{"system": "http://loinc.org", "code": "55412-1", "display": "Exercise distance unspecified time"}]}, "valueQuantity": {"value": distance, "unit": "[mi_us];km"}})
if heart_rate:
observation.component.append({"code": {"coding": [{"system": "http://loinc.org", "code": "55422-0", "display": "Heart rate Encounter maximum"}]}, "valueQuantity": {"value": heart_rate, "unit": "{beats}/min"}})
return observation
# Function to create an Observation resource on the FHIR server
def create_observation(observation):
headers = {"Content-Type": "application/fhir+json"}
response = requests.post(base_url + "Observation", data=json.dumps(observation.as_json()), headers=headers)
if response.status_code == 201:
st.success("Observation created successfully!")
else:
st.error("Error creating Observation.")
# Streamlit user interface
def app():
st.title("LOINC Exercise Tracking Panel")
activity = st.text_input("Exercise activity")
category = st.selectbox("Exercise aerobic category", ["", "Aerobic", "Anaerobic"])
calories = st.number_input("Calories burned (Machine estimate)", min_value=0, step=1)
duration = st.number_input("Exercise duration (minutes)", min_value=0, step=1)
distance = st.number_input("Exercise distance unspecified time", min_value=0, step=0.01)
heart_rate = st.number_input("Heart rate Encounter maximum", min_value=0, step=1)
if st.button("Record Exercise"):
observation = create_observation_resource(activity, category, calories, duration, distance, heart_rate)
create_observation(observation)
